#TurksandCaicos, December 6, 2022 – Turks and Caicos Islanders will be able to see some familiar spots on Netflix come December 7th as their islands are the backdrop for reality TV show Too Hot to Handle once again; this time for the show’s fourth season.

A consistent success last year’s season was watched by more than 60 million households worldwide.  The unscripted show focuses on a group of young adults dropped off in paradise who must all remain celibate for length of their stay in the Turks and Caicos or forfeit $100,000.

During season three, contestants were fooled into thinking they had auditioned for a totally different series and it seems the gag carried over into season four as well based on the trailer.  TV show host Mario Lopez and the Netflix production crew armed with a plane and several cars decked out with the name of a fake show “Wild Love” broke the news to contestants setting off what will likely be another hit season.

The newest season hits Netflix on December 7th in a format not unlike the uber popular Stranger Things with half the season dropping first and the other half made available to viewers at a later date.
